Market Trends

Modern consumers are moving away from basic vinyl toward "hybrid" systems. Wooden sliding windows are now being integrated with Aluminum cladding (Alu-Clad) to provide the warmth of wood interiorly and the durability of metal exteriorly.

🔹 What makes Wooden Sliding Windows more energy-efficient than standard frames?
Wood is a natural insulator with low thermal conductivity. When combined with Nova Panel’s precision weather-stripping and Low-E double glazing, these windows can significantly reduce heating and cooling costs by preventing thermal bridging.

🔹 How do you ensure the durability of wooden frames in humid climates?
We utilize advanced surface treatments and moisture-barrier coatings. For extreme humidity, we often recommend our "Hybrid" systems which use a uPVC or Aluminum exterior skin with a genuine wood interior, providing the best of both worlds.
